OSUT training takes place at Fort Moore (formerly Fort Benning), in Georgia. The job training for 11B requires 22 weeks of One Station Unit Training (OSUT) which is a combination of 10 weeks in boot camp and 12 weeks in AIT spent in the classroom and in the field.*īasic training and advanced job training are combined into a single course. Training for an Army Infantryman consists of two sections: Basic Combat Training (BCT) and Advanced Individual Training. Related Article – Air Force Combat Controller (CCT) (1C2X1): Career Details Training Soldiers must meet a “very heavy” strength requirement and physical profile requirement of 111221.Ĭorrectable vision must be 20/20 in one eye, and 20/100 in the other eye.Ĭolor Vision discrimination for MOS 11B is red/green. No high-security clearance is required to become an Army Infantryman. Now, there are additional weapon qualifications including handling M4 rifles, M240 machine guns, and M249 squad automatic weapons. There are a number of standards and qualifications you need to meet to become MOS 11B, especially since the Army expanded its OSUT training in 2019. Training to become MOS 11B is open to both men and women.
